What does MASS mean in Technology, IT etc.

MASS meaning is defined below:

Major Account Support Specialist
ADVERTISEMENT

Was it useful?

What does MASS mean? It stands for Major Account Support Specialist

Most popular questions

What does MASS stand for?


MASS stands for "Major Account Support Specialist"

How to abbreviate "Major Account Support Specialist"?


"Major Account Support Specialist" can be abbreviated as MASS

What is the meaning of MASS abbreviation?


The meaning of MASS abbreviation is "Major Account Support Specialist"

What does MASS mean?


MASS as abbreviation means "Major Account Support Specialist"

Related Acronym Searches